K’s Choice – The Great Subconscious Club – Review

December 1, 1994 Bands, CDs, Indie/Alternative Review, Reviews

K’s Choice

The Great Subconscious Club (Sony)
by unknown

Brussels’ Sarah and Gert Bettens create some nice, light floaty pop music together. Intelligent lyrics, sultry vocals and a few rockin’ passages. More your “over 25” type of disc.
